AI gateways serve as the critical point of control for routing, compliance enforcement, and cost allocation in enterprise AI deployments. As adoption trends move toward hybrid decision-making, let’s define the two main models:
Control & Residency: Operate entirely within your environment, on-premises or private cloud. Data never leaves your perimeter and you set all system parameters.
Security & Compliance: Ideal when meeting strict regulations on data sovereignty, compliance frameworks, or sensitive workload isolation is the top priority.
Operational Effort: You are responsible for setup, scaling, patching, and lifecycle management.
Simplicity: Run as-a-service by a provider, abstracting away deployment, scaling, and maintenance tasks.
Feature Acceleration: Typically roll out new integrations, caching, and security upgrades rapidly as centralized SaaS.
Trust Shift: Data and runtime are in the vendor’s domain, making vendor assurance critical for regulated sectors.

Let’s break down the tradeoffs from an enterprise perspective:
|
Consideration |
Self-Hosted Gateway |
Managed Gateway |
|---|---|---|
|
Data Control |
Full ownership, meets strict residency needs |
Data may leave premises, depends on vendor controls |
|
Compliance |
Highest auditability, in-house enforcement |
Up to vendor’s compliance framework |
|
Operational Load |
Internal teams manage scaling and outages |
Offloaded to vendor, faster go-live |
|
Scalability |
Requires proactive resourcing |
Elastic, handled by provider |
|
Feature Rollout |
Customization possible, but slower upgrades |
Rapid access to new capabilities |
|
Cost Governance |
Cost is more predictable, but requires careful tracking |
Subscription-based, variable usage-based billing |
Expert insight: The crossover point often hinges on the cost of avoided engineering effort compared to ongoing platform fees. If data residency, audit trails, and direct control are first-order needs, self-hosted wins; for fast scaling and minimal management, managed will appeal.

Here’s a practical, risk-based framework for evaluating which model is right for your needs:
Define Compliance Needs: If data sovereignty, PII leakage prevention, or custom auditability is a top-tier requirement, lean toward self-hosted or hybrid with strong controls.
Map Operational Constraints: If engineering capacity is limited and speed-to-value is critical, managed may win.
Quantify Cost Governance Requirements: Do you need granular budgeting, chargeback, and real-time visibility into how different business units use and spend on AI? If so, a solution with robust cost allocation (like CloudNuro AI Custodian) is non-negotiable.
Check Integration Demands: Will the gateway integrate seamlessly into existing ITSM, security, and SaaS management tooling?
Plan for Growth: Can your chosen model scale as business lines, AI models, and regulatory needs grow or shift?

What are the key pros and cons of self-hosted vs managed AI gateways?
Self-hosted gateways lead in data residency, auditability, and fine-grained control but require more internal operational investment. Managed gateways simplify scaling and lifecycle management, with quick upgrades and lower day-to-day engineering burden, at the cost of giving some data/control to a vendor.
